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Jötunnslayer: Hordes of Hel?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1060 handles Jötunnslayer: Hordes of Hel well at 1080p, delivering approximately 131 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 98 FPS.

About

Jötunnslayer: Hordes of Hel, released in 2025, combines action and RPG elements within a roguelike horde-survivor framework inspired by Norse mythology. Players take on the role of a god-like warrior, tasked with fighting through relentless waves of enemies while earning divine blessings from ancient gods. The game's blend of intricate combat and exploration allows for an engaging experience as players face formidable bosses in dark, hostile realms.

When it comes to PC performance, Jötunnslayer is accessible to a wide range of gamers, requiring only an entry-level GPU with a minimum score of around 6138 and a CPU score of approximately 6204. With 8 GB of RAM as the baseline, gamers can expect playable FPS even on lower settings. For smoother gameplay, a mid-range GPU such as the NVIDIA GTX 1650 or AMD RX 550 may provide a better experience while balancing performance and graphics settings.
